I’ve been an 870 user my whole life, and my M4 is my first shotgun that is semi auto. Loading rounds in every 870 I’ve  owned has been smooth like butter. On the M4 it’s hard as hell. The shell extractor lip always gets hung up on the shell holder and have to jam it in even harder. Makes loading 4 a nightmare since I have small hands. Sends shells flying everywhere. I noticed that the shell holder spring is stiff as hell. Do people mod these to soften them up? It’s not an issues with the magazine tube spring being too stiff. It’s strictly an issue with the thing that holds the shells in the tube. The shells get hung up on the extractor rim because the spring is so stiff. I have to jam the shell with my thumb into the tube. Any advice would be greatly appreciated.

ADHESIVE SANDPAPER (fine grit)

Cut a small 1inch X 2inch piece and stick it to a dummy round.  Thumb it in and out, dont press it all the way in as to let it go past the shell stop.

Doing this will create a polished indention on the shell stop lip. 

Stop sanding when your satiated.?  and dont sand all the way through it...lol!

Smooth as butter when your done!
